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"situation was rectified"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to indicate that a problem or issue has been resolved or corrected. Example: "After several discussions, the situation was rectified, and both parties were satisfied with the outcome."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

Use "situation was rectified" when you want to indicate that a specific problem or undesirable circumstance has been successfully corrected or resolved. Ensure that the context clearly identifies the "situation" being referred to.

Common error

Avoid using "situation was rectified" without clearly defining what the "situation" refers to. Ensure that the context provides enough information for the reader to understand which problem has been resolved. If the context is ambiguous, clarify by explicitly stating the issue that was rectified.

FAQs

What does "situation was rectified" mean?

The phrase "situation was rectified" means that a particular problem, issue, or undesirable circumstance has been corrected or resolved, returning it to a more favorable or acceptable condition. It indicates that action was taken to address and fix the situation.

What can I say instead of "situation was rectified"?

You can use alternatives such as "matter was resolved", "problem was fixed", or "issue was addressed" depending on the context.

Is "situation was rectified" formal or informal?

The phrase "situation was rectified" is generally considered neutral to formal in tone. While not overly technical, it is suitable for professional, news-related, and academic contexts. More informal alternatives include phrases like "problem was fixed".

How to use "situation was rectified" in a sentence?

Use "situation was rectified" to indicate that a previously problematic or undesirable circumstance has been corrected or resolved. For example, "After several discussions, the situation was rectified, and both parties were satisfied with the outcome."
